![]() ![]() Turn it in the mixture once so that both sides get an ample coat. Take your slices of bread (or your sandwich) and place in your shallow dish to coat it with the custard. (Note: Since stuffed French toast uses two slices of bread, you want that bread to be thinner. Try to leave a little space around the border of the bread to help the two slices seal together when soaked. ![]() Making stuffed French toast is as easy as making a sandwich: Spread one slice of your brioche or other bread with whatever you want inside your French toast-mascarpone, jam, Nutella, peanut butter-then sandwich another slice on top.
